Job Summary
We're looking for an organized, motivated Criminal Defense Paralegal to support our attorneys in a fast-paced criminal defense practice. This is an excellent opportunity for someone starting their legal career who is eager to learn, stay organized, and make a meaningful impact. You'll help manage cases, communicate with clients, prepare legal documents, and keep cases moving from start to finish.
Responsibilities
- Organize case files, evidence, and legal documents
- Assist attorneys in preparing for hearings, trials, and client meetings
- Conduct legal research and gather case information
- Draft and prepare legal documents, including motions, subpoenas, and discovery requests
- Maintain accurate case files and update the case management system
- Communicate with clients, courts, law enforcement, and other parties
- Protect confidential client information and follow office procedures
